In narrower sense those so called “thermal solar collectors” or “solar collectors” are not even appropriate solar panels. So what is the difference?
Solar panels (photovoltaic panels, photovoltaic modules) convert shortwave radiation, e.g. parts of the sunlight, into electrical power. They consist of interconnected solar cells which are protected by a range of unique materials. The surface is transparent and the solar panel is framed, mostly in an aluminum frame.
Solar collectors on the other hand, are a system of liquid filled tubes. Sunlight heats up the tubes and the liquid. A heat exchanger now transfers the heat to the facility water circuit for warm water and heating. You may possibly want to appear especially at the following information:
Solar cell itself – what sort of semiconductor material is getting employed?
— Monocrystalline silicon cells (c-Si) have an efficiency degree of more than 20%
— Polycrystalline silicon cells (mc-Si) have an efficiency of 16%
— Flat film amorphous silicon cells (a-Si) have an efficiency of 5%–7% (most effective solar panels in sales at
thetime)
— Microcrystalline silicon cells (µc-Si) in combination with a-Si cells have up to 10%
— Gallium-Arsenik cells (GaAs), Cadmium-Tellur cells (CdTe) and Chalkopyrite cells (CIS, CIGS) have degrees of efficiency from 10 to over 40% (GaAs). They are not (yet) appropriate for most private shoppers, simply because either they are quite expensive or they are not completely developed, however.
— Panels containing organic solar cells might develop into the most effective solar panels in the future, as they can be created at relatively low costs. At this time their efficiency is still low (pigmented Grätzel-cells have max. 10 %, others are lower) and their life expectancy is brief (5000 hours). But retain them in thoughts for portable electric devices.
Solar module efficiency
Constantly look at the efficiency of the total solar module, not only of the person solar cell and be conscious that higher efficiency degrees are nothing devoid of a higher minimum warranted energy rating. (see subsequent paragraph)
Solar module power rating
It tells you about the wattage of the particular solar electric module. Operation voltage
Open circuit voltage, stated in Volts (V), is the maximum voltage a solar cell produces when illuminated and not connected to a load. The hotter the Solar Panels get, the decrease the open circuit voltage gets.
